Serenade, where the nights are long and strange is a 4-channel video installation, filmed during a month-long residency in the island of Örö, Finland. Kim documents spaces that testify to our fleeting and impermanent existence, while acclimating herself to a foreign environment. Using the digital projector to light up the long winter nights, Kim’s videos collapse time as she searches for the familiar in the foreign landscape—a place between the documented site and a state of abstraction. The exhibition invites us to hear and see the mystified nocturnal landscape as it is lit up by Kim’s video projections. What may seem ordinary in daylight is transformed anew, as time is visually compressed.
